6 Equipment Checkout 3 DAY CHECKOUT (Transcription pedals remain in the lab for 1 day checkout. Transcription laptop is a 2 day checkout) NO MORE THAN 4 CONSECUTIVE CHECKOUTS (12 DAYS TOTAL) Late returns incur $20.00 fee for each day beyond the due date Checkout Policy To checkout equipment, please come to KRH 210. You will be asked to fill out an Equipment Checkout Form and include your name, DU ID, email address, and phone number. The equipment must be returned to the Technology Team in KRH 210. Checkout/In Times Equipment can typically be checked out or checked back in during normal business hours, 8:00 a.m. to 5:00 p.m. Monday through Friday (Summer Quarter) in KRH 210. For your own convenience, however, please contact the Technology Team at extension 1-3222 before going to KRH 210 to obtain or return equipment. This might save you time, in that you can confirm that someone is there and that the equipment you want is available. Equipment Inventory and Replacement Failure to return equipment or failure to pay for damages to equipment can result in a withholding of your diploma until the matter is settled.
